Lakers Lead Series 2-0

Where: AT&T Center
Television: TNT
Tip-Off: 5:30



Los Angeles Lakers Starting Line-Up



ImageImageImageImageImage
Fisher Bryant Radmanovic Odom Gasol




San Antonio Spurs Starting Line-Up


ImageImageImageImageImage
Parker Bowen Finley Oberto Duncan


What The Lakers Are Saying:

"There's certain areas there, where we have to minimize their open looks," Bryant said. "Some of those shots if they knock down, all of a sudden it cuts a 12-point lead into a nine-point lead and things can kind of get mucked up. Those are the shots that they aren't going to miss the next game."


"This series is far from over. It's probably going to be even more than what we expect as far as the intensity and how hard they're going to be playing and how focused we are going to have to be to try to go out there and come out with a win. We are going to have to be even more ready than we were last time."


"They're going to be hungry," Lamar Odom said. "This is a team that's won championships before, they know what it takes. We have to get ready for a fight."
